Pointsman

Simple haproxy docker image redirecting HTTP => HTTPS behind an AWS ELB

Usage

docker run -p 8080:8080 -p 8081:8081 -e HEALTH_CHECK_URI=/check -e FRONTEND_PORT=8080 -e BACKEND_HOST=172.17.0.1 -e BACKEND_PORT=3000 --name pointsman airvantage/pointsman

Binds your ELB HTTP and HTTPS listeners on FRONTEND_PORT and your backend with BACKEND_HOST and BACKEND_PORT. We also open :8081 port for the ELB health check on URI HEALTH_CHECK_URI.
